Abstract
A driver circuit is disclosed for use in testing bi-directional transceiver semiconductor products using a minimum of time and number of product accessing pins. The driver includes a pair of controllable amplitude current sources whose output currents are selectably switched into or partially away from the commonly connected emitters of a current switch. The current switch is energized by a variable voltage source and produces the output test voltage.
